Dr.T wrote:
> I want to make my oracle 10g queries case insensitive.
> 
> To do this, I need to execute:
> 
> alter session set NLS_SORT=BINARY_CI;
> alter session set NLS_COMP=LINGUISTIC;
> 
> at application initialization.
> 
> How might I do this via SQLAlchemy?
> 
> Thanks for your help,

class MySetup:
    def connect(self, dbapi_con, con_record):
        dbapi_con.execute('alter session set NLS_SORT=BINARY_CI')
        dbapi_con.execute('alter session set NLS_COMP=LINGUISTIC')

engine = create_engine('oracle:...', listeners=[MySetup()])

--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the Google Groups 
"sqlalchemy" group.
To post to this group, send email to sqlalchemy@googlegroups.com
To unsubscribe from this group, send email to [EMAIL PROTECTED]
For more options, visit this group at 
http://groups.google.com/group/sqlalchemy?hl=en
-~----------~----~----~----~------~----~------~--~---

Reply via email to